If you have the windows 7 Cd there’s nothing wrong for trying to install it but make sure you backed up your data first or install the windows 7 on other partition. Any hardware with Vista driver usually will be running ok on windows 7.

Most hardware trouble is the VGA and Sound card. These are the most critical part on installing windows 7 on older hardware specs. For example on sound card, you will have the jack slots different between windows xp and windows 7.

On your windows XP the blue slot could be line out to speaker/headphones while on windows 7 it could be a line in jack. Also the VGA software and drivers, sometimes it will not work and it required latest software to run on windows 7. 

And even till now there’s so many people having trouble on their soundcard (including laptop). Sometimes it will blue screen of death, computer crash and not responding, and many more bugs on your windows 7  screen especially the aero theme (where it should be running fine but without proper driver aero theme can’t start).

So, how to install windows 7 on your older hardware specs? If you found the above problems when running windows 7 you should revert back to Xp or (option 2) is to upgrade your motherboard.
